What is the difference between an "Unlinked" and a "Linked" receipt?

Unlinked means the receipt is in your inbox but not yet converted into an expense. Linked means it is associated with a transaction in your Expense Tracker.

An Unlinked receipt is a document or image sitting in your Receipts inbox that has not yet been converted into an expense.

Once processed, it becomes a Linked receipt, meaning it is associated with a transaction in your Expense Tracker.

The status lets you see at a glance which purchases are already accounted for in your project budget, and which receipts still need to be filed.
